ESD protection for chip-cards (f.e. Telematic)
Description
There are problems with many doctors in Germany reading the chip cards (insurance card). This seems to be due to the fact that the cards charge statically and then cause the card reader to crash. This attachment here can be stuck over the card slot. In addition, a cheap anti-static wristband is needed, which is then connected to a grounding point (e.g., PC case, grounding at a power outlet or similar). This automatically removes static charge from the card when it is inserted, and crashes will at least occur much less frequently.
